Main duties of the job

You will assist the General Manager in addressing the Trust's strategic and operational agenda as it relates to the services concerned. They will oversee day to day service management issues, liaising with departments and teams as required.

You will deputise for the General Manager as required.

The role requires an individual with a relevant professional qualification and experience in the management of people and services.

You will promote the service and manage partnership relations with stakeholders working with other Service Managers and Operational Managers.

You will plan and oversee the implementation of the service improvement and development agenda to meet the Elective Recovery national target.

You will ensure compliance with clinical and operational standards and contractual requirements ensuring regular reporting to all stakeholder groups as required by the Divisional Board.

About us

At East and North Hertfordshire NHS Trust, we are proud of the range of general & specialist services we provide & our 6,000 or so dedicated staff ensure our patients get the best care. Our ability to be flexible & innovative in the way in which we work and deliver our services to our catchment has never been more important than it is now.

We run the following hospitals:

  • The Lister Hospital, Stevenage
  • New Queen Elizabeth II (New QEII), Welwyn Garden City
  • Hertford County, Hertford
  • Mount Vernon Cancer Centre (MVCC), Northwood

We have ambitious plans to become an outstanding, patient-led Trust where dedicated staff provide high-quality, compassionate care to our patients. We continue to undergo significant transformation; our staff & patients are at the heart of delivering this ambitious agenda.
